Eastland PD Adds Two New K-9 Officers
EASTLAND — The Eastland Police Department has officially welcomed two new K-9 officers to its ranks. During a recent interview with Eastland County Today reporter Levi Freeman on Rip’s Report, Sergeant Ronnie Allman introduced the department’s newest four-legged officers, Doc and Ice.
Sergeant Allman explained that both K-9s have undergone extensive training and will assist officers in a variety of law enforcement duties, including narcotics detection and patrol support. The addition of Doc and Ice strengthens the department’s ability to respond quickly and effectively to incidents while enhancing public safety across the community.
